github.com/taemin-kwon93 Github 보러가기 ->

Dev.Kwon Tae Min 78

[국비지원 일지]21.06.01

21.06.01 15:00 - 출석&내일배움카드 출결 15:20 - 줌 접속 _1교시 15:30 - 수업시작, 15:36 - 지난 수업시간에 메소드(오버로딩) 전 까지 했음. 15:48 - 생성자는 클래스 명과 동일한 이름을 갖고있고 리턴값이 없다. 메소드는 리턴값이 있을 때도 있고 없을 때도 있다. _2교시 16:30 - 수업시작, static 멤버 학습 시작. 16:43 - 객체 마다 가지고 있어야 할 데이터 -> 인스턴스 필드, 공용적인 데이터 -> 정적(static)필드. 16:50 - 정적 멤버는 클래스이름과 함께 도트 연산자를 써서 접근한다. 예를들어, //정적멤버 public class Calculator{ static double pi = 3.14; static int plus(int x,..

[국비지원 일지]21.05.28

21.05.28 15:10 - 출석체크 15:25 - 줌 기록 시작 _1교시 15:30 - 수업시작, 클래스에는 변수, 메소드, 생성자가 들어간다. 15:44 - OOP(Object Oriented Programming): 객체지향 프로그래밍. 15:55 -객체지향의 특징 3가지 캡슐화 상속, 그리고 다형성. 캡슐화란 객체의 필드, 메소드를 하나로 묶고, 실제 구현 내용을 감추는 것이다. 필드와 메소드를 캡슐화하여 보호하는 이유는 외부의 잘못된 사용으로 인해 객체가 손상되지 않게 하려는 것이다. _2교시 16:30 - 수업시작, 16:57 - 알고리즘은 메소드 내에서 활용된다. 자바 API(라이브러리 용도)를 잘활용하는것이 중요한 능력이다. 객체의 구조를 짜고 API를 활용하는 것이 핵심. 17:08 -..

[국비지원 일지]21.05.27

21.05.27 15:20 - 줌 실행 & 출석체크 15:28 - 줌 기록 시작 _1교시 15:30 - 수업시작, 5장 참조타입 시작. 16:02 - String은 문자열을 담는 타입이며, 참조타입으로 많이 사용된다. 16:04 - String name1 = new String("가나다"); new 연산자는 힙 메모리상에 영역을 생성한다. _2교시 16:30 - 수업시작, 배열 학습시작. 배열과 반복문을 활용해 작업을 단순화 시킬 수 있다. 예를들어, int sum = score1; sum += score2; sum += score3; ... sum += score30; int avg= sum/30; int sum = 0; for(int i=0; i

[국비지원 일지]21.05.26

21.05.26(수요일 오프라인 출석) 15:08 - 집에서 일찍 나왔으나 버스가 제시간에 오지 않아서 택시타고 학원에 도착함 15:28 - 맥북 열고 줌 실행, 줌 기록 시작 _1교시 15:35 - 수업시작, 선생님께서 노트북 추천 해주심 (다나와 사이트 참고, 선생님 개인의견 - 온라인 주문이 더 좋다고 하셨습니다) 노트북과 데스크탑은 CPU가 다르게 들어간다. 노트북용 CPU는 i3~i7간의 차이가 크지 않다 ssd는 사용된 프로그램을 바로 삭제할시 512GB도 충분하다.(CPU와 메모리가 중요함) 15:45 - 로그인은 ID와 비밀번호가 필요하다. ID와 비밀번호의 조건에 따라서 결과가 나온다. 조건문 15:50 - 제어문이 있기에 조건문과 반복문을 활용해 여러 경우들을 제어 할수있다. 오늘은 조..

[국비지원 일지]21.05.25

21.05.25(화요일 온라인 출석) 15:20 - 줌 실행 & 출석체크 15:22 - 줌 기록 시작 _1교시 15:30 - 수업시작, 3장 '연산자' 학습 시작 15:45 - 비트, 쉬프트 연산자는 게임에서 주로 쓰인다. 웹에서는 거의 사용되지 않는다. 15:51 - 전위 증감 ++a, 후위 증감 a++ 16:00 - 부호연산자는 int타입이 기본이다. _2교시 16:30 - 수업시작, 신호출결 완료 16:38 - ~연산자는 비트를 반전시킨다 16:55 - 오버플로우 17:03 - 부동소수점, 연산을 소수점자리로 했을때 결과 값이 정확하게 나오지 않는다. 정수로 만든다음 만든만큼의 값을 다시 나누어준다. 17:09 - Infinity와 NaN(not a number) 값을 입력받아 결과물을 출력할 경우..

[국비지원 일지]21.05.24

[시간별 기록] 14:55 - 학원도착 15:00 - 출석체크(오프라인, 내일배움카드로 출석) 15:10 - 입실 _1교시 15:30 - 수업시작 15:30 - 온라인 줌 출석체크 15:33 - 제로베이스에서 작업 시작 15:39 - 오라클사이트에서 자바(8버전)를 다운받음 15:46 - 이클립스 IDE 다운로드 진행 15:55 - jdk와 이클립스 설치 진행 16:06 - cmd를 이용하기 위해서는 자바 환경변수 설정을 한다. 이클립스를 사용할 경우 환경 설정을 따로 할 필요는 없다. cmd 내에서 컴파일을 하기 위해서는 환경변수 설정을 해야한다. 16:10 - 이클립스 파일 압축해제중 문제가 발생하였음. 압축해제파일 다운로드 후 다시 진행할것(이클립스 삭제, 재설치) 16:17 - 재설치 진행중 16..

[국비지원 일지]21.05.21

15:10 - Zoom 참가 ID문의 후 접속. 15:10 - 참가후 HRD_QR 인증 완료. 15:30 - 수업시작, OT진행 20:00 - 자바 언어에 대한 기본적인 설명. [05.21 업데이트] -5.21 - 12.21 (7개월) 공휴일 (9/20, 9/21, 922)은 출석하지 않습니다. 대체공휴일에 쉬게 될 경우 학원에서 미리 공지합니다. - 퇴실은 9:40이후에 해야함, 그 이전 시간에 퇴실처리하면 조퇴처리가 됩니다. 출석체크 방법 -> 온라인 QR코드, 오프라인 내일배움카드 오프라인 출석시 카드를 찍고 이름이 제대로 떴는지 확인할것.(카드 분실시 QR로 출석 가능함.) -취업하게 될시에는 재직증명서, 근로계약서, 취업확인서 등 지급할것. [수업시간] 2021.05.21 ~ 2021.12.21..

[국비지원 일지]21.05.14

[국비지원 과정] 1. 강의는 5월 21일부터 12월 21일까지 진행됩니다. 2. 수업은 온라인 방식과 오프라인 방식으로 나뉘어 진행됩니다. 3. 총 인원은 21명이며, 조를 편성하여 진행합니다. 4. A조(10명)와 B조(11명)로 나뉘고 각 조는 일정에 맞추어 온라인 오프라인 수업을 받게됩니다. 4-1. 예를들어, A조가 24일부터 28일까지 한주 동안 온라인 교육을 진행한다면, B조는 해당 일에 오프라인으로 교육을 받습니다. [5.14 업데이트] 1. 강의중 Q&A는 마이크를 끄고 채팅창을 이용합니다. 2. 강의오티는 5월 21일 진행됩니다. 3. 학원에 도착하면 내일배움카드를 3층 단말기에 찍고 출석합니다. 4.온라인으로 출석할 때는 QR코드를 찍어 출석체크합니다.(HRD어플을 이용해서 출석체크)..